Authorities still searching for man presumed drowned in Pymatuning


ANDOVER

The search continued Tuesday for Lawrence Elroy Page, 47, of Pittsburgh, who is believed to have drowned in Pymatuning Lake after jumping from a pontoon boat into 20 feet of water at about 6 p.m. Saturday to help a woman get back aboard.

On Tuesday, an Ohio State Highway Patrol plane performed an aerial search of the 26-square-mile lake, which straddles the Ohio-Pennsylvania border, said Daniel Bickel, Pennsylvania’s Pymatuning State Park manager.

Meanwhile, Pennsylvania State Police used boat-mounted sonar to search the lake, with divers ready to enter the water if sonar found anything needing further examination, he said.

Nine people were aboard the pontoon boat, which was rented from Birches Landing on the Ohio side of the lake. Page jumped into the water near where the boat was rented, Bickel said.
